About the role

As Assistant Headteacher with a focus on English, you will work closely with the Headteacher and other senior leaders to develop and implement strategies that improve student outcomes, support teacher development, and promote the delivery of an engaging and inspiring English curriculum.

Key Responsibilities:

Develop and implement the English curriculum, ensuring it meets the needs of all students.

Monitor and evaluate student progress, identifying areas for improvement and providing targeted support.

Work collaboratively with other senior leaders to drive school-wide improvements and initiatives.

Foster a culture of high expectations, achievement, and continuous professional development within the department.

Promote reading, literacy, and a love for English both within and outside the classroom.

Ensure the department’s resources and teaching practices are innovative, effective, and responsive to the changing needs of students.

The Ideal Candidate:

A qualified teacher with extensive experience in teaching English at Key Stage 3 and 4.

Proven leadership experience, ideally in a middle or senior leadership role within a school.

A deep understanding of the English curriculum and a commitment to delivering high standards of education.

Strong communication, organizational, and interpersonal skills.

A passion for improving student outcomes and raising standards across the school.

The ability to inspire and motivate staff and students alike

At The Westleigh School, we place the utmost importance on the wellbeing and professional development of our staff. We believe that happy, supported educators are the key to unlocking the potential in our students. That’s why we prioritise a healthy work-life balance, continuous professional growth, and a collaborative, nurturing environment. We are proud to be a school that has enabled more staff than ever before to complete National Professional Qualifications (NPQs), and we remain fully committed to supporting ongoing development at every stage of a teacher’s career. Whether you're an early career teacher or an aspiring leader, we invest in your journey because we know that developing great teachers leads to great outcomes.

We are a school driven by excellence and innovation. As a fully digital school, every staff member and student is equipped with an iPad, allowing for creative, high-impact teaching strategies and interactive learning experiences. Our strong pastoral system, built around a thriving college model, fosters healthy competition, a deep sense of belonging, and a shared determination to be the best in all areas of school life. At The Westleigh School, we don’t just aspire to excellence—we create the conditions for it, empowering our staff and students to achieve their full potential together.
